Deep Dive into The Pilgrim's Progress by John Bunyan - Proceeds to the CrossChristian's journey along the highway, fenced by the wall called Salvation, was initially difficult due to a heavy burden on his back. He ran with this load until he reached a place that was somewhat ascending, where a cross stood, and a sepulchre lay a little below it in the bottom.Precisely as Christian came up with the cross, his burden miraculously loosed from his shoulders and fell off his back. It then tumbled downwards, continuing until it reached the mouth of the sepulchre, fell in, and he saw it no more.Immediately, Christian felt glad and lightsome. He experienced a great sense of relief, attributing his rest and life to the sorrow and death represented by the cross. He was profoundly surprised that the mere sight of the cross could ease him so completely. He stood still, looking and wondering at the place where his burden fell, and he wept.While he was looking and weeping, three Shining Ones appeared. They greeted him with "Peace be to thee." The first declared, "Thy sins be forgiven thee." The second stripped him of his rags and clothed him "with change of raiment." The third set a mark on his forehead and gave him a sealed roll to look at as he ran and give in at the Celestial Gate.After the Shining Ones departed, Christian reacted with immense joy, giving three leaps and singing about his liberation from sin and grief at this blessed place.
